Permits & Licensing

Permits in Centennial

Centennial building permits, inspections, and contractor license approvals are handled by the city's Building Division. Permits and contractor licenses must be applied for online through the city's Self-Service Portal, and we handle that process as part of every project. Authority: City of Centennial — Building Division.

Permit Thresholds

Centennial permit thresholds

Code reference
In Centennial, Colorado, building permits for residential remodel work are governed by the 2021 International Residential Code (IRC) Section R105 (adopted via Centennial Municipal Code Chapter 18 – Building Regulations, per Ordinance 2023-O-06 and related adoptions of the 2021 I-Codes).Section R105
Code reference
Typically exempt work (aligning with IRC R105.2 exemptions, with local application) includes:
Code reference
One-story detached accessory structures (e.g., sheds) ≤200 sq ft.
Code reference
Fences ≤7 ft high; retaining walls ≤4 ft high (measured from bottom of footing).
Code reference
Prefabricated swimming pools <24 inches deep.
Code reference
Window awnings projecting ≤54 inches.
Code reference
Decks ≤200 sq ft, ≤30 inches above grade, and not attached to the dwelling.
Use tax (not collapsed into a single rate)
City of Centennial Use Tax of 2.5% applied to the actual cost of materials, plus Arapahoe County Use Tax of 0.25% applied to the actual cost of materials.

Codes are amended regularly — verify current requirements with City of Centennial — Building Division.

Technical scope

Multiple listening zones from a central amp or streamer stack. Typical: 8-ohm or 70-volt zones, keypads or app source select, and outdoor zones on a separate amp. Speaker rough-in happens with electrical; finishing waits for paint.

text

How the work is coordinated

Speaker rough-in happens with electrical; finishing waits for paint. Denver-metro work is permitted locally. Colorado has no statewide general-contractor license. Cities and counties license general contractors. DORA licenses electrical and plumbing (and similar regulated trades), not general contractors. Autotelic is a municipally licensed Denver general contractor that coordinates licensed specialty trades. Denver building permits run through Community Planning and Development (CPD).
